Exploring the World of E-commerce Packaging: Trends, Sustainability, and Popular Solutions
E-commerce has revolutionized the way we shop and do business, making it more convenient for consumers to purchase products from the comfort of their own homes. However, the increasing popularity of online shopping has also led to a surge in the demand for e-commerce packaging. In this blog, we will explore the world of e-commerce packaging, including its importance, trends, sustainability, and popular solutions.
Importance of E-commerce Packaging
E-commerce packaging is an essential component of the overall customer experience. It is not only responsible for protecting the product during shipment, but it also serves as a physical representation of the brand. An e-commerce package that is visually appealing, easy to open, and functional can help build brand loyalty and leave a positive lasting impression on the customer.
Moreover, e-commerce packaging plays a critical role in reducing product returns due to damage during shipment. According to a study by Dotcom Distribution, 34% of customers who received a damaged package from an online order would not order from the same retailer again. Therefore, it is crucial for businesses to invest in high-quality packaging solutions that can protect their products and prevent damage during transit.
Trends in E-commerce Packaging
E-commerce packaging trends are continually evolving to meet the changing needs and preferences of customers. Here are some of the current trends that are shaping the world of e-commerce packaging:
- Minimalism: Minimalist packaging is a trend that has gained popularity in recent years. This trend is characterized by simple designs, clean lines, and a focus on eco-friendliness. Minimalist packaging can help businesses reduce their environmental impact and create a memorable unboxing experience for customers.
- Personalization: Personalized packaging is another emerging trend in e-commerce packaging. Personalized packaging can include everything from custom wrapping paper to personalized messages on the box. This trend can help businesses create a stronger connection with their customers and differentiate themselves from their competitors.
- Biodegradable and Compostable Materials: With increased awareness of the impact of plastic on the environment, businesses are turning to biodegradable and compostable materials for e-commerce packaging. These materials are more environmentally friendly and can help reduce waste.
- Smart Packaging: Smart packaging is an emerging trend that involves the use of technology to enhance the functionality of packaging. For example, QR codes can be used to provide customers with additional information about the product or to track the package’s delivery status.
Popular E-commerce Packaging Solutions
There are various e-commerce packaging solutions available that can help businesses enhance their customer experience, reduce costs, and improve sustainability. Here are some of the popular e-commerce packaging solutions:
- Corrugated Boxes: Corrugated boxes are one of the most popular e-commerce packaging solutions. These boxes are made of multiple layers of paperboard that provide excellent cushioning and protection during shipment. Corrugated boxes are recyclable and can be customized with various designs and sizes.
- Poly Mailers: Poly mailers are lightweight and durable plastic bags that are ideal for shipping soft goods such as clothing, accessories, and textiles. These bags are waterproof, tear-resistant, and can be customized with various designs and sizes. Poly mailers are also recyclable and can be reused multiple times.
- Bubble Mailers: Bubble mailers are similar to poly mailers but feature an extra layer of bubble wrap padding for added protection. These mailers are ideal for shipping delicate or fragile items such as electronics, glassware, and ceramics. Bubble mailers are recyclable and can be customized with various designs and sizes.
- Padded Envelopes: Padded envelopes are a popular e-commerce packaging solution for shipping small, lightweight items such as jewelry, cosmetics, and stationery. These envelopes are lined with padded material, providing extra cushioning and protection during transit. Padded envelopes come in various sizes and designs, and they are also recyclable
Sustainability in E-commerce Packaging
Sustainability is a critical issue in e-commerce packaging, with consumers increasingly demanding more eco-friendly options from businesses. Here are some ways that businesses can address sustainability in their e-commerce packaging:
- Use of Eco-friendly Materials: Businesses can switch to eco-friendly materials such as recycled paper, cardboard, and biodegradable plastics for their e-commerce packaging. These materials are more environmentally friendly and can help reduce waste.
- Optimal Sizing: Optimal sizing of packaging can help reduce waste and the use of excess materials. Businesses should choose packaging sizes that are appropriate for their products to avoid using unnecessary materials.
- Lightweight Packaging: Lightweight packaging can help reduce the carbon footprint of transportation and shipping. Businesses should choose lightweight packaging solutions that provide adequate protection while using minimal materials.
- Innovative Packaging Designs: Innovative packaging designs can help reduce waste and increase the reusability of packaging. For example, businesses can use packaging that can be repurposed or upcycled, or they can implement reusable packaging solutions such as tote bags.
- Recycling Programs: Recycling programs can help reduce waste and promote sustainability. Many businesses are implementing recycling programs for their packaging materials, allowing customers to recycle their packaging after use.
